Output 5b2884bcc68d1dfae4906bfb3673d24c4be5de0f99c55044068cea112125e4b7:3

value
15966563
script pubkey
OP_HASH160 OP_PUSHBYTES_20 77b2761652685410a43f69865390cb03fca755b4 OP_EQUAL
address
3Cbv85WXFyH3W1BfRimE4FqLwCAuY2k9eJ
transaction
5b2884bcc68d1dfae4906bfb3673d24c4be5de0f99c55044068cea112125e4b7
confirmations
232080
spent
true